Plant Care & Growing Tips
Caring for your Callisia Repens Pink Lady live plant is a rewarding experience, as it is generally quite forgiving. To ensure optimal growth and the most vibrant pink coloration, understanding its basic needs is key. This plant thrives in conditions that mimic its native tropical environment, focusing on appropriate light, watering, and humidity.
For lighting, the ‘Pink Lady’ prefers bright, indirect light. Too much direct sunlight can scorch its delicate leaves and fade its vibrant pink hues, while too little light will cause the plant to stretch and lose its variegation. An east- or north-facing window is often ideal, or a spot a few feet away from a south- or west-facing window. If you notice the pink fading, try moving it to a brighter location. When it comes to watering, the key is consistency without overwatering. Allow the top inch of soil to dry out between waterings. Stick your finger into the soil to check; if it feels dry, it’s time to water. Ensure your pot has drainage holes to prevent root rot. This plant appreciates moderate humidity, so occasional misting or placing it near a humidifier can be beneficial, especially in dry indoor environments. Understanding creeping inch plant care is crucial for maintaining its health.
A well-draining potting mix is essential for the Pink Panther plant. A standard houseplant mix amended with perlite or orchid bark will provide the necessary aeration and drainage. Fertilize sparingly during the growing season (spring and summer) with a balanced liquid fertilizer diluted to half strength, typically once a month. Reduce or stop fertilizing during the dormant winter months. The ideal temperature range for this plant is between 65-75°F (18-24°C). Avoid exposing it to temperatures below 50°F (10°C), as it is not frost-tolerant. While generally robust, keep an eye out for common houseplant pests like spider mites or mealybugs; address them promptly with insecticidal soap if spotted. Pruning can encourage bushier growth and maintain its desired shape, and the cuttings are easily propagated, allowing you to expand your collection or share with friends. Frequently Asked Questions
- Q: How big does this plant get? A: The Callisia Repens Pink Lady live plant is a trailing plant. Its individual stems can grow to trail up to 12-18 inches or more, creating a lush, cascading effect. The spread depends on how you prune and grow it, but it can easily fill a hanging basket.
- Q: Is this an indoor or outdoor plant? A: While it can be grown outdoors in very warm, frost-free climates (USDA zones 9-11), the ‘Pink Lady’ is primarily cultivated and sold as an indoor houseplant in most regions. It thrives in typical indoor temperatures and conditions.
- Q: How much sunlight does it need? A: This plant thrives in bright, indirect light. Too much direct sun can scorch its leaves and cause the pink variegation to fade, while too little light will result in leggy growth and less vibrant color. A north or east-facing window is often ideal for optimal Pink Panther plant color.

- Q: How often should I water my ‘Pink Lady’ plant? A: Water your Turtle Vine care plant when the top inch of soil feels dry to the touch. It prefers consistently moist, but not soggy, soil. Always ensure the pot has drainage holes to prevent waterlogging.
- Q: Will it survive winter in my zone? What’s the minimum temperature? A: As a tropical plant, it is not frost-hardy. It prefers temperatures between 65-75°F (18-24°C) and should not be exposed to temperatures below 50°F (10°C). If grown outdoors, bring it inside before the first frost.
- Q: How can I make my ‘Pink Lady’ plant more pink? A: To encourage the most vibrant pink coloration, ensure your plant receives ample bright, indirect light. Good light exposure is crucial for the development of its unique variegation, distinguishing it from other pink Tradescantia.
- Q: Can I propagate this plant? A: Absolutely! The ‘Pink Lady’ is very easy to propagate from stem cuttings. Simply snip a healthy stem section, remove the lower leaves, and place it in water or moist soil. Roots will typically form within a few weeks.
- Q: What kind of soil is best for this plant? A: A well-draining potting mix is best. You can use a standard houseplant soil amended with perlite or orchid bark to improve drainage and aeration, which is vital for healthy root development in Callisia Repens Pink Lady live plant.
